    "content": "This class represents a colour space by defining its YCbCr encoding,\nthe transfer (gamma) function is uses, and whether the output is full\nor limited range.\n\nSigned-off-by: David Plowman <david.plowman@raspberrypi.com>\n---\n include/libcamera/color_space.h |  94 +++++++++++++++++\n include/libcamera/meson.build   |   1 +\n src/libcamera/color_space.cpp   | 180 ++++++++++++++++++++++++++++++++\n src/libcamera/meson.build       |   1 +\n 4 files changed, 276 insertions(+)\n create mode 100644 include/libcamera/color_space.h\n create mode 100644 src/libcamera/color_space.cpp",
    "diff": "diff --git a/include/libcamera/color_space.h b/include/libcamera/color_space.h\nnew file mode 100644\nindex 00000000..3d990f99\n--- /dev/null\n+++ b/include/libcamera/color_space.h\n@@ -0,0 +1,94 @@\n+/* SPDX-License-Identifier: LGPL-2.1-or-later */\n+/*\n+ * Copyright (C) 2021, Raspberry Pi (Trading) Limited\n+ *\n+ * color_space.h - color space definitions\n+ */\n+\n+#ifndef __LIBCAMERA_COLOR_SPACE_H__\n+#define __LIBCAMERA_COLOR_SPACE_H__\n+\n+#include <string>\n+\n+namespace libcamera {\n+\n+class ColorSpace\n+{\n+public:\n+\tenum class Encoding : int {\n+\t\tUNDEFINED,\n+\t\tRAW,\n+\t\tREC601,\n+\t\tREC709,\n+\t\tREC2020,\n+\t\tVIDEO,\n+\t};\n+\n+\tenum class TransferFunction : int {\n+\t\tUNDEFINED,\n+\t\tIDENTITY,\n+\t\tSRGB,\n+\t\tREC709,\n+\t};\n+\n+\tenum class Range : int {\n+\t\tUNDEFINED,\n+\t\tFULL,\n+\t\tLIMITED,\n+\t};\n+\n+\tconstexpr ColorSpace(Encoding e, TransferFunction t, Range r)\n+\t\t: encoding(e), transferFunction(t), range(r)\n+\t{\n+\t}\n+\n+\tconstexpr ColorSpace()\n+\t\t: ColorSpace(Encoding::UNDEFINED, TransferFunction::UNDEFINED, Range::UNDEFINED)\n+\t{\n+\t}\n+\n+\tstatic const ColorSpace UNDEFINED;\n+\tstatic const ColorSpace RAW;\n+\tstatic const ColorSpace JFIF;\n+\tstatic const ColorSpace SMPTE170M;\n+\tstatic const ColorSpace REC709;\n+\tstatic const ColorSpace REC2020;\n+\tstatic const ColorSpace VIDEO;\n+\n+\tEncoding encoding;\n+\tTransferFunction transferFunction;\n+\tRange range;\n+\n+\tbool isFullyDefined() const\n+\t{\n+\t\treturn encoding != Encoding::UNDEFINED &&\n+\t\t       transferFunction != TransferFunction::UNDEFINED &&\n+\t\t       range != Range::UNDEFINED;\n+\t}\n+\n+\tconst std::string toString() const;\n+};\n+\n+constexpr ColorSpace ColorSpace::UNDEFINED = { Encoding::UNDEFINED, TransferFunction::UNDEFINED, Range::UNDEFINED };\n+constexpr ColorSpace ColorSpace::RAW = { Encoding::RAW, TransferFunction::IDENTITY, Range::FULL };\n+constexpr ColorSpace ColorSpace::JFIF = { Encoding::REC601, TransferFunction::SRGB, Range::FULL };\n+constexpr ColorSpace ColorSpace::SMPTE170M = { Encoding::REC601, TransferFunction::REC709, Range::LIMITED };\n+constexpr ColorSpace ColorSpace::REC709 = { Encoding::REC709, TransferFunction::REC709, Range::LIMITED };\n+constexpr ColorSpace ColorSpace::REC2020 = { Encoding::REC2020, TransferFunction::REC709, Range::LIMITED };\n+constexpr ColorSpace ColorSpace::VIDEO = { Encoding::VIDEO, TransferFunction::REC709, Range::LIMITED };\n+\n+static inline bool operator==(const ColorSpace &lhs, const ColorSpace &rhs)\n+{\n+\treturn lhs.encoding == rhs.encoding &&\n+\t       lhs.transferFunction == rhs.transferFunction &&\n+\t       lhs.range == rhs.range;\n+}\n+\n+static inline bool operator!=(const ColorSpace &lhs, const ColorSpace &rhs)\n+{\n+\treturn !(lhs == rhs);\n+}\n+\n+} /* namespace libcamera */\n+\n+#endif /* __LIBCAMERA_COLOR_SPACE_H__ */\ndiff --git a/include/libcamera/meson.build b/include/libcamera/meson.build\nindex 5b25ef84..7a8a04e5 100644\n--- /dev/null\n+++ b/src/libcamera/color_space.cpp\n@@ -0,0 +1,180 @@\n+/* SPDX-License-Identifier: LGPL-2.1-or-later */\n+/*\n+ * Copyright (C) 2021, Raspberry Pi (Trading) Limited\n+ *\n+ * color_space.cpp - color spaces.\n+ */\n+\n+#include <libcamera/color_space.h>\n+\n+/**\n+ * \\file color_space.h\n+ * \\brief Class and enums to represent colour spaces.\n+ */\n+\n+namespace libcamera {\n+\n+/**\n+ * \\class ColorSpace\n+ * \\brief Class to describe a color space.\n+ *\n+ * The color space class defines the encodings of the color primaries, the\n+ * transfer function associated with the color space, and the range (sometimes\n+ * also referred to as the quantisation) of the color space.\n+ *\n+ * Certain combinations of these fields form well-known standard color spaces,\n+ * such as \"JFIF\" or \"REC709\", though there is flexibility to leave some or all\n+ * of them undefined too.\n+ */\n+\n+/**\n+ * \\enum ColorSpace::Encoding\n+ * \\brief The encoding used for the color primaries.\n+ *\n+ * \\var ColorSpace::Encoding::UNDEFINED\n+ * \\brief The encoding for the colour primaries is not specified.\n+ * \\var ColorSpace::Encoding::RAW\n+ * \\brief These are raw colours from the sensor.\n+ * \\var ColorSpace::Encoding::REC601\n+ * \\brief REC601 colour primaries.\n+ * \\var ColorSpace::Encoding::REC709\n+ * \\brief Rec709 colour primaries.\n+ * \\var ColorSpace::Encoding::REC2020\n+ * \\brief REC2020 colour primaries.\n+ * \\var ColorSpace::Encoding::VIDEO\n+ * \\brief A place-holder for video streams which will be resolved to one\n+ * of REC601, REC709 or REC2020 once the video resolution is known.\n+ */\n+\n+/**\n+ * \\enum ColorSpace::TransferFunction\n+ * \\brief The transfer function used for this colour space.\n+ *\n+ * \\var ColorSpace::TransferFunction::UNDEFINED\n+ * \\brief The transfer function is not specified.\n+ * \\var ColorSpace::TransferFunction::IDENTITY\n+ * \\brief This color space uses an identity transfer function.\n+ * \\var ColorSpace::TransferFunction::SRGB\n+ * \\brief sRGB transfer function.\n+ * \\var ColorSpace::TransferFunction::REC709\n+ * \\brief Rec709 transfer function.\n+ */\n+\n+/**\n+ * \\enum ColorSpace::Range\n+ * \\brief The range (sometimes \"quantisation\") for this color space.\n+ *\n+ * \\var ColorSpace::Range::UNDEFINED\n+ * \\brief The range is not specified.\n+ * \\var ColorSpace::Range::FULL\n+ * \\brief This color space uses full range pixel values.\n+ * \\var ColorSpace::Range::LIMITED\n+ * \\brief This color space uses limited range pixel values.\n+ */\n+\n+/**\n+ * \\fn ColorSpace::ColorSpace(Encoding e, TransferFunction t, Range r)\n+ * \\brief Construct a ColorSpace from explicit values\n+ * \\param[in] e The encoding for the color primaries\n+ * \\param[in] t The transfer function for the color space\n+ * \\param[in] r The range of the pixel values in this color space\n+ */\n+\n+/**\n+ * \\fn ColorSpace::ColorSpace()\n+ * \\brief Construct a color space with undefined encoding, transfer function\n+ * and range\n+ */\n+\n+/**\n+ * \\fn ColorSpace::isFullyDefined() const\n+ * \\brief Return whether all the fields of the color space are defined.\n+ */\n+\n+/**\n+ * \\brief Assemble and return a readable string representation of the\n+ * ColorSpace\n+ * \\return A string describing the ColorSpace\n+ */\n+const std::string ColorSpace::toString() const\n+{\n+\tstatic const char *encodings[] = {\n+\t\t\"UNDEFINED\",\n+\t\t\"RAW\",\n+\t\t\"REC601\",\n+\t\t\"REC709\",\n+\t\t\"REC2020\",\n+\t};\n+\tstatic const char *transferFunctions[] = {\n+\t\t\"UNDEFINED\",\n+\t\t\"IDENTITY\",\n+\t\t\"SRGB\",\n+\t\t\"REC709\",\n+\t};\n+\tstatic const char *ranges[] = {\n+\t\t\"UNDEFINED\",\n+\t\t\"FULL\",\n+\t\t\"LIMITED\",\n+\t};\n+\n+\treturn std::string(encodings[static_cast<int>(encoding)]) + \"+\" +\n+\t       std::string(transferFunctions[static_cast<int>(transferFunction)]) + \"+\" +\n+\t       std::string(ranges[static_cast<int>(range)]);\n+}\n+\n+/**\n+ * \\var ColorSpace::encoding\n+ * \\brief The encoding of the color primaries\n+ */\n+\n+/**\n+ * \\var ColorSpace::transferFunction\n+ * \\brief The transfer function for this color space.\n+ */\n+\n+/**\n+ * \\var ColorSpace::range\n+ * \\brief The pixel range used by this color space.\n+ */\n+\n+/**\n+ * \\var ColorSpace::UNDEFINED\n+ * \\brief A constant representing a fully undefined color space.\n+ */\n+\n+/**\n+ * \\var ColorSpace::RAW\n+ * \\brief A constant representing a raw color space (from a sensor).\n+ */\n+\n+/**\n+ * \\var ColorSpace::JFIF\n+ * \\brief A constant representing the JFIF color space usually used for\n+ * encoding JPEG images.\n+ */\n+\n+/**\n+ * \\var ColorSpace::SMPTE170M\n+ * \\brief A constant representing the SMPTE170M color space (sometimes also\n+ * referred to as \"full range BT601\").\n+ */\n+\n+/**\n+ * \\var ColorSpace::REC709\n+ * \\brief A constant representing the REC709 color space.\n+ */\n+\n+/**\n+ * \\var ColorSpace::REC2020\n+ * \\brief A constant representing the REC2020 color space.\n+ */\n+\n+/**\n+ * \\var ColorSpace::VIDEO\n+ * \\brief A constant that video streams can use to indicate the \"default\"\n+ * color space for a video of this resolution, once that is is known.
